Araldite® AV 4738 / Hardener HV 4739 – Two-component epoxy paste adhesive for bonding metals and reinforced composites, suitable for potable water applications.

  • Item Name: Araldite® AV 4738 / Hardener HV 4739

  • Manufacturer: Huntsman Advanced Materials

  • Technologies: Epoxy paste adhesive, ambient temperature curing

  • Color: AV 4738 – Light grey, HV 4739 – Pale grey, Mixed – Grey

  • Cure Type: Ambient temperature curing with optional post-cure at elevated temperatures (80–130°C)

1. Product Overview

Araldite® AV 4738 with Hardener HV 4739 is a two-component epoxy paste adhesive designed for structural bonding of metals and composites. It cures at ambient temperature and can be post-cured to enhance mechanical strength, chemical resistance, and temperature resistance (up to 150 °C). The adhesive is a non-flowing, gap-filling paste suitable for both manual and mechanical application.


2. Applications

  • Bonding metals and reinforced composites such as GRP, GRE, ABS, SMC.

  • Composite pipe bonding.

  • High-strength structural joints requiring chemical resistance.

  • Situations requiring gap filling and non-sag application.

  • Potable water applications (KIWA approval filed).

3. Typical Properties

Before Mixing

Component Appearance Density (g/cm³) Viscosity (25 °C)
Araldite® AV 4738 (Resin) Light grey thixotropic paste 1.45 – 1.55 500 – 800 Pa·s
Hardener HV 4739 Pale grey thixotropic paste 1.75 – 1.85 34 – 64 Pa·s
Mixed adhesive Grey paste ~1.6

Mixing Ratio:

  • By weight → 100 : 25–27.5

  • By volume → 100 : 22–23

(100:27.5 by weight increases glass transition temperature slightly)


Mixed System / Processing Data

Property Condition Value
Pot life 100 g at 25 °C 40 – 50 min
Gel time 40 °C 40 – 50 min
Lap shear strength on aluminium 23 °C, 24h cure > 10 MPa
Glass transition temperature (Tg ½) ≥ 120 °C
Minimum shear strength 25 °C cure, 3h > 1 N/mm²
Minimum shear strength 60 °C cure, 15 min > 1 N/mm²

Curing Schedules:

  • Ambient cure: good performance after 24h at 23 °C.

  • Recommended post-cure: 2 h at 80 °C or 1 h at 120 °C (or in-service post-cure).


Cured Properties (typical values)

Property Condition Value
Lap shear strength (metals, ISO 4587) Al, Steel, Stainless Steel, Cu, Brass 15 – 25 N/mm²
Lap shear strength (plastics, ISO 4587) PVC, Acrylic, ABS, SMC, PC 5 – 10 N/mm²
Roller peel test (ISO 4578) Al, 7d cure + post-cure 2.6 – 5.6 N/mm
Lap shear vs. temperature 23–120 °C 8 – 18 N/mm²
Lap shear after chemical immersion (90 days at 23 °C) Water, acids, oils, methanol, etc. 5 – 15 N/mm² (depending on medium)
Lap shear vs. tropical weathering (90 days) Retains ~70–80% strength
Lap shear vs. water immersion (GRE substrates) Up to 2000 h at 23 °C–100 °C Maintains good adhesion
